Output 2f651d7a244229158c1bdcd2aeb4d4a91fd41383ae013c708c9205bd3d6c6291:51

value
17802144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 142b90c8d3cddde30aa36c3f977c8e68bd9e8512 OP_EQUALVERIFY OP_CHECKSIG
address
LM4by3ARifZ6NP7VnaNgxoFt731VajdKq2
transaction
2f651d7a244229158c1bdcd2aeb4d4a91fd41383ae013c708c9205bd3d6c6291
spent
true